Profile
JWH Design & Cabinetry LLC is a premier kitchen remodeler based in Rye, New York, specializing in custom cabinetry and innovative interior design solutions. With a strong reputation for quality craftsmanship and personalized service, JWH has been transforming kitchens, baths, and full home interiors for over two decades. The company blends function and style by offering tailor-made designs that reflect each client’s unique needs and preferences. Their process integrates advanced in-house CAD capabilities, ensuring precise visualizations and seamless execution from concept to completion.
Led by Jennifer Howard, a seasoned designer with a passion for transformative spaces, JWH stands out for its attention to architectural detail and commitment to client collaboration. Their showroom showcases a wide range of handcrafted cabinetry built locally, highlighting materials and finishes that are both durable and elegant. JWH serves homeowners, architects, and builders throughout Westchester County and the surrounding areas. They are also active in community development and local design initiatives, fostering strong relationships with clients and the community alike.
